Philadelphia Eagles sign explosive WR in high-upside move
The Philadelphia Eagles entered the 2025β26 season with high hopes but fell short in the postseason. They finished with strong starters but needed depth at receiver. Missing a reliable third option hurt them in the wild-card loss. Management moved quickly this offseason.
NFL free agency and trade talks heated up around the league. Teams are chasing for playmakers and short-term upside. Philly watched the market and targeted a veteran who could help now. Rumors about bigger names also swirled, which kept the discussion around A.J. Brown alive.

Marquise Brown spent last season with the Kansas City Chiefs. He played 16 games and finished with 49 catches for 587 yards and five touchdowns on 74 targets. He also posted a 66.2% catch rate last year. The 5β9β³, 180-pound speedster broke out as a primary threat with the Baltimore Ravens in 2021, when he had 91 catches for 1,008 yards and six touchdowns, per Bleacher Report.
βBreaking: The Eagles are signing former Chiefs WR Marquise βHollywoodβ Brown to a 1-year, deal worth up to $6.5M,β Jordan Schultz reported.

The club signed Brown to a one-year deal worth up to $6.5 million.
Brown brings deep speed and suddenness after the catch. He can win vertically and stretch zones. He also creates space for the top two receivers. On one-year terms the financial risk for Philly stays low. The contract lets the team evaluate fit without a long commitment.
Coaches can use him in single-receiver sets and in space. If he stays healthy, he gives the offense more explosive play options.
The signing aims to fix a clear roster need with measured risk and strong upside. Injuries hampered him between 2022 and 2024, but his playmaking remains. This is a low-cost, high-reward addition for the teamβs offense and depth. Expect him to compete immediately.
